Elbe Estuary Cluster project

The Elbe Estuary Cluster (Cluster Elbmündung) project involves construction of dedicated infrastructure for transmission, liquefaction, temporary storage and onward transmission of unavoidable CO2 emissions from cement production in Schleswig-Holstein. The CO2 is captured in Lägerdorf and exported for permanent geological storage via the designated terminal in Brunsbüttel, or made available to the chemical industry, including Covestro’s Brunsbüttel industrial park, as a raw material for the manufacture of chemical products such as plastics. 

Together with powerful partners, a CO2 cluster is being created here, which is scheduled to go into operation at the end of 2029. Within the project consortium, OGE is responsible for the construction of the approx. 30 km-long underground CO2 pipeline.
